Four People Injured in Semi-Truck Accident on Highway 93

White Hills, Arizona—Four people were injured in an accident involving a semi-truck and two pickup trucks on Sunday night in the northbound lanes of U.S. Highway 93.  One person was flown to University Medical Center in Las Vegas.  No information on that person’s condition is available. Three others were transported by ambulance to Kingman Regional Medical Center for treatment of their injuries.  They were released shortly thereafter.

The Arizona Department of Public Safety reported the northbound lanes of U.S. 93 were closed for several hours during the accident investigation.  First responders were from the Lake Mohave Rancho Fire District.

DPS officials have not released any information regarding what caused the accident.  The names of those who were injured are presently not available.
